Corriere dello Sport have revealed some of the details involved in the joint plan from Davide Manica and Cmr for Inter and AC Milan’s proposed new stadium.

Much has been seen when it comes to the rival bid from American architecture firm Populous but very few details have come out about the Manica-Cmr project until now.

The main feature of the stadium is two intersecting rings, one blue and one red, which obviously will signify the two clubs that would be calling the stadium their home if Manica-Cmr win the race.

The stadium will have a variable capacity starting at 60,000 but able to rise to 65,000 due to there being space left for more seats to be added as and when required.

Corriere dello Sport go on to reveal that with thanks to 16,000 mobile panels, it will be possible for outside of the stadium to change colours dependent on who is playing at home.

It will be a sustainable stadium too, capable of producing energy from renewable sources and a stadium which will have the LEED certificate.
